Benin - Import of Petroleum Based Lubricanting Oil

Since 2014, Benin Import of Petroleum Based Lubricanting Oil was up 41.7%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 111 comparing other countries in Import of Petroleum Based Lubricanting Oil with $733,334.83. Benin is overtaken by Ivory Coast, which was ranked number 110 at $733,651.94 and is followed by Albania with $726,215.52. China ranked the highest with $668,572,531.43 in 2019, an increase of 3.3% compared to 2018. Germany, Russia and Canada resp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Solomon Islands witnessed the best average annual growth at +100.1% per year, while Tanzania recorded the worst performance at -26% per year.
